Transaction 5df28469342c8188b373110bed00e32863c6b0f8e3387a295bb2f58ce543121e

4 Input
2 Outputs
  • 5df28469342c8188b373110bed00e32863c6b0f8e3387a295bb2f58ce543121e:0
  • value  200000000
    address  34kvHBApfZ7HiV6rocWeFbySBB2YHYe3DM
  • 5df28469342c8188b373110bed00e32863c6b0f8e3387a295bb2f58ce543121e:1
  • value  614507
    address  3H5D9TbPXb2f9urS3twf3vrX1jFMPtQi8e